Output d238085822bd309f60112f87a525078796528929de504db8a8fe0c2f855d22b3:22

value
16357538
script pubkey
OP_HASH160 OP_PUSHBYTES_20 29b35c0d590fa9d98a8f45f152884a0d1335d7f1 OP_EQUAL
address
MBheoR9qcm6Etcmwp42yxL3KiCMCS7rA1T
transaction
d238085822bd309f60112f87a525078796528929de504db8a8fe0c2f855d22b3
spent
true